What is Contextual Targeting?
Contextual Targeting matches Ads to the content of the page being read, rather than to a profile of the person reading it. We read the words on the URL in real time and place your Ads beside relevant food content, across premium brand safe inventory.
Is Contextual Targeting Privacy Compliant?
Yes. Contextual Targeting uses no cookies and no personal data. The decision is made on what the page is about, not on who the reader is or where they have been, so it works the same way in every market regardless of local privacy rules and browser changes.
